To choose a solid shampoo that will be effective on your hair and give you good hair results, certain selection criteria are universal. They allow you to identify a quality solid shampoo, which will not damage your hair. here are the specific ingredients that characterize a quality solid shampoo :

  • To choose a good solid shampoo, select one with vegetable oils. Oils have different properties but they all have the particularity of taking care of your hair by hydrating and nourishing it deeply. There are a large number of them but among the most common you will find: coconut oil, castor oil, jojoba, almond, hazelnut, and black seed. Consider choosing an oil that matches your hair type.
how-to-choose-solid-shampoo
  • To choose a good solid shampoo, pay attention to the surfactants present in it. Choose one with mild surfactants:
  • Sodium Coco Sulphate
  • Disodium Cocomamphodiacetate
  • Disodium Laureth Sulfosuccinate
  • Sodium Lauryl Sulfoacetate
  • Or very mild surfactants:
  • Sodium Cocoyl Isethionate
  • Coco Glucoside 
  • Decyl Glucoside 
  • Disodium Cocoyl Glutamate 
  • Lauryl Glucoside 
  • Sodium Cocoyl Glutamate 
  • Choose a solid shampoo with vegetable or Ayurvedic powders. These also have the particularity of taking care of your hair. They have purifying, regulating and cleansing actions. There are for all types of hair: Rhassoul, Reetha, Shikakaï, Sidr, Nettle, Neutral Henna, Clay, Marshmallow etc.
  • Try to choose a solid shampoo with vegetable butters especially if you have dry and / or frizzy hair. Indeed, they are very effective in deeply hydrating your hair. You will most commonly find shea butter. But also cocoa or mango butter.
  • A solid shampoo contains essential oils or not. Consider choosing your solid shampoo based on this ingredient. Indeed, essential oils have very interesting properties for the hair (purifying, regulating, anti-hair loss, etc.). However, some people can be intolerant. In the event that when you use your solid shampoo, your scalp starts to itch, you notice hair loss or even dandruff appears when you are not usually subject to it, choose a shampoo without essential oils the next time.

Which solid shampoo to choose for my oily hair

Hair that greases quickly needs active ingredients that regulate sebum and the scalp. Therefore, to choose an effective solid shampoo for oily hair, here are the ingredients to favor in solid shampoos:

  • Essential oils effective in preventing oily hair: Lemon, Ylang Ylang, Cypress, Cedar, Basil, Grapefruit, Lemon Litsé, Lavender, Rosemary, Sage, and Bay Saint Thomas.
  • To choose a solid shampoo for oily hair, take one that contains a powder in its composition. They are ideal for regulating a scalp in a natural way. Indeed, they purify, sanitize and cleanse it in a gentle way, without attacking it. These powders are: Clay, neutral Henna, Rhassoul, Shikakai, Nettle, Nagarmotha and Reetha.
  • Hydrating and nutritious oils. Some oils will tend to grease your hair, while others have a function to regulate your sebum. The best oils for oily hair found in solid shampoos are: Jojoba, Camellia, Macadamia, Coconut, Nigella, and Inca inchi oils.

Which solid shampoo to choose for my dry hair

Dry hair needs hydration. Therefore, to choose an effective solid shampoo for dry hair, here are the ingredients to look for in solid shampoos:

  • Personalized essential oils special anti-dryness: Geranium from Egypt, Geranium Bourbon, Sandalwood Alba, Lavender, Rosemary or Ylang-Ylang. 
  • Personalized moisturizing oils and nutritious: Vegetable oils of coconut, argan, avocado, baobab, camellia, jojoba, brazil nut, or castor. They are very nutritious and hydrating. 
  • Personalized moisturizing butters and having nutritive assets: cocoa, shea, kokum or mango butter. 
  • The best solid shampoo for dry hair can also consist of keratin of vegetable origin (or phytokeratin).

Which solid shampoo to choose for dandruff and itching

Problematic hair (which has dandruff and itching) needs active ingredients that regulate sebum and the scalp. Therefore, to choose an effective anti-dandruff solid shampoo, here are the ingredients to favor in solid shampoos:

  • Ayurvedic, mineral or vegetable powders. They are ideal for regulating a scalp in a natural way and avoiding itching. Indeed, they purify, sanitize and cleanse it gently, without attacking it. These powders are: Clay, Neutral Henna, Rhassoul, Sidr, Brahmi, Neem, Shikakai, Nettle, Nagarmotha and Reetha.
  • Special anti-dandruff essential oils : Orange, Palmarosa, Cedar, Lemon Eucalyptus, Rosemary Cineole, Sandalwood, Lavender, Clary Sage, Tea Tree, Rosemary Cineole, Chamomile, Lemon and Ylang Ylang.
  • Vegetable oils to soothe and moisturize your scalp: Sweet almond, Argan, Jojoba, Camellia, Nigella, Castor.

Which solid shampoo to choose for my colored hair

Curly hair will require hydration, and active ingredients that can provide it with suppleness and shine. Therefore, to choose an effective solid shampoo to maintain your color and the health of your hair, here are the ingredients to favor in solid shampoos:

  • To choose a solid shampoo for colored hair, select one that contains vegetable oil in its composition : coconut, castor, olive, jojoba, argan, grape seeds, camellia, nigella, coconut, sesame, flax, and broccoli.
  • In one solid shampoo for colored hair effective, you will find the following essential oils : For the beauty and shine of the hair, the EOs of Rose, Ylang Ylang, bergamot, basil, bigarade petitgrain, atlas cedar, geranium, ylang ylang, tangerine, and grapefruit. To lighten your hair, the essential oils of lemon, orange, and chamomile are ideal. So be careful if you do not want your hair to lighten.
  • To choose a good solid shampoo for colored hair, choose those with powders ayurvedic, mineral or vegetable. Some powders allow colored hair not to bleed, and fix the color to the hair fiber. This is the case with Sidr powder or Alma powder. We recommend the latter if you have a dark or brown color.
  • The best solid shampoo for colored hair can also be made with phytokeratin.
